As Jon recommends those are another option, I took his advice many years ago and have one of those on my MK 2.
With regard to the MK 3 I had at first thought they'd be too large, but on having just compared the two they're only a fraction larger, you will need to enlarge the opening but at least you'll know they can be made to fit.

As Jon said. I had these on the bumper Jon gave me, plus I had them on my original bumper too. Just slightly bigger than original hole and a lot better built. Less likely to fall apart like the Allegro ones do....and the bulb replacement facility is better made.
